{"product_id":"3929-mini","title":"Brotherhood in Arms: US Paratrooper Rescue","description":"During the chaotic drops of Operation Overlord and Market Garden, paratroopers frequently found themselves isolated and under immediate attack, making the rescue of wounded brothers a grim necessity. The bond within airborne units was exceptionally strong, with men often risking their lives to ensure no comrade was left behind in enemy-controlled territory.
